#ifndef C_NATFWREPOSITORYHANDLER_H
#define C_NATFWREPOSITORYHANDLER_H
#include <e32base.h>
class CRepository;
/**
* Class provides methods for make easier the usage of Central Repository.
*
* @lib natsettings.lib
* @since S60 v3.2
*/
class CNATFWCenRepHandler : public CBase
{
public:
/**
* Two-phased constructor.
*/
static CNATFWCenRepHandler* NewL( const TUid& aRepositoryUid );
/**
* Destructor.
*/
virtual ~CNATFWCenRepHandler();
/**
* Create new Central Repository key for setting
* if settings haves already keys it increase the biggest key by one
*
* example: CR have keys 10010001 and 10010002.
* aSettingKeyMask = 10010000, aFieldMask = fffff000
* return value = 00000003.
*
* @since S60 3.2
* @param aSettingKeyMask Keymask for the setting
* @param aFieldMask Field for the setting keymasks
* @return New CR key
* @leave KErrNone if successful or system wide error code from CR
*/
TUint32 CreateNewKeyL( const TUint32 aSettingKeyMask,
const TUint32 aFieldMask ) const;
/**
* Reads domain settings key by using domain name for search.
*
* @since S60 3.2
* @param aDomain Domain name which is searched from
* the Central Repository
* @param aDomainKey Returns discovered CR key
* @return KErrNone if successful, KErrCorrupt if more than one
* key found or System wide error code from CR
*/
TInt ReadDomainSettingsKey(
const TDesC8& aDomain, TUint32& aDomainKey ) const;
/**
* Reads IAP settings key from Central Repository
* using IAP ID for search.
*
* @since S60 3.2
* @param aIapId Which is searched from Central Repository
* @param aIapKey Returns discovered CR key
* @return KErrNone if successful, KErrCorrupt if more than
* one key found or System wide error code from CR
*/
TInt ReadIapSettingsKey( TInt aIapId, TUint32& aIapKey ) const;
/**
* Finds and returns server keys from given partialId.
*
* @since S60 3.2
* @param aPartialId Contains a bit pattern that all the keys returned
* must at least partially match
* @param aFoundKeys All the keys found
* @return KErrNone if successful or system wide error code from CR
*/
TInt FindServerKeys(
TUint32 aPartialId, RArray<TUint32>& aFoundKeys ) const;
/**
* Reads boolean value from the Central Repository
*
* @since S60 3.2
* @param aKey ID wanted to be read
* @param aKeyValue Read value
* @return KErrNone if successful, KErrNotFound if the setting does not
* exist or system wide error code
*/
TInt ReadBoolValue( const TUint32& aKey, TBool& aKeyValue ) const;
/**
* Reads TUint value from the Central Repository
*
* @since S60 3.2
* @param aKey ID wanted to be read
* @param aKeyValue Read value
* @return KErrNone if successful, KErrNotFound if the setting does not
* exist or system wide error code
*/
TInt Read( const TUint32& aKey, TUint& aKeyValue ) const;
/**
* Reads TInt value from the Central Repository
*
* @since S60 3.2
* @param aKey ID wanted to be read
* @param aKeyValue Read value
* @return KErrNone if successful, KErrNotFound if the setting does not
* exist or system wide error code
*/
TInt Read( const TUint32& aKey, TInt& aKeyValue ) const;
/**
* Reads descriptor from the Central Repository
*
* @since S60 3.2
* @param aKey ID wanted to be read
* @return CR data, NULL if not found
* @leave KErrNoMemory if memory allocation fails
*/
HBufC8* ReadL( const TUint32& aKey ) const;
private:
CNATFWCenRepHandler();
void ConstructL( const TUid& aRepositoryUid );
private: // data
/**
* Central Repository
* Own.
*/
CRepository* iCenRep;
};
#endif // C_NATFWREPOSITORYHANDLER_H
